Poor durability, not for do-it-yourselfers

Bought for drilling holes in concrete. RIGID represented quality between professional and homeowner. As a DIY enthusiast, I thought I had a "for life" drill. After the completion of the first work, it was not used for almost two years. No scratches, looks like new. Today I had to drill twenty 1/2 inch diameter and about 2.5 inch deep holes in the concrete so I could insert rebar into the "old" concrete and bond to the "new" concrete. I pre-drilled with a 1/4" bit. When drilling with a 1/2" bit, the bit burned out. Very disappointed. met me unexpectedly I had to rent a drill press to finish this little DIY project. Do not buy this drill. There's just no quality. Repair is not even an option. Looks like new, was in the trash. What a waste.
